they were purchaced on ebay for about $170 + shipping.
The clear sides are apart of the head lights its a one piece unit. There quality is better then i thought they would be. As i said though there are some fitment isued with mine but i think that i can fix it as theres no issues on my buddies truck. there quite bright, id say about as much as stock however i wouldnt get these if your looking for light performance. They change the style and look of the cruiser while maintaining the stock performance of light.
